Understanding the Ownership Structure

The relationship between Camping World and Good Sam has evolved over the years. To understand the current ownership, we need to look at the history of both entities.

Camping World: A Leader in RV Sales and Services

Founded in 1966, Camping World has grown from a single store into the largest retailer of RVs and related products in the United States. The company specializes in a variety of outdoor recreation items, including:

  • RV sales
  • Parts and accessories
  • Insurance and financing services
  • Camping gear

With a commitment to enhancing the RV experience, Camping World has expanded its footprint, acquiring numerous RV dealerships across the country. This growth has positioned Camping World as a major player in the outdoor recreation market.

Good Sam: The Ultimate Camping Companion

Good Sam, on the other hand, was established in 1966 as a club for RV owners and campers. The organization offers a wide range of services designed to support outdoor enthusiasts, including:

  • Camping discounts at thousands of campgrounds
  • Roadside assistance
  • Travel planning resources
  • Insurance products

Good Sam has cultivated a loyal membership base and is known for its travel clubs and community events that foster connections among RVers and campers.

The Acquisition: A Major Business Move

In 2011, Camping World made a significant move by acquiring Good Sam Enterprises, Inc. This acquisition allowed Camping World to integrate Good Sam’s offerings into its business model, providing a more comprehensive service to the RV community.

As a result of this acquisition, Good Sam became a subsidiary of Camping World, further solidifying Camping World’s position in the outdoor recreation industry. This relationship has enabled Camping World to offer exclusive benefits to Good Sam members, such as:

  • Discounts on Camping World products
  • Special promotions for RV buyers
  • Access to a wider network of campgrounds and services

Troubleshooting Tips for RV Owners

As part of the RV community, it’s important to be prepared for common issues that may arise during camping trips. Here are some troubleshooting tips for RV owners:

Electrical Problems

If you experience electrical issues while camping, consider the following steps:

  • Check your circuit breakers and fuses.
  • Inspect your battery connections for corrosion.
  • Ensure your RV is plugged into a reliable power source.

Water System Issues

For problems related to your RV’s water system, take these steps:

  • Inspect for leaks in water lines and fittings.
  • Check your water pump for proper functioning.
  • Ensure that your fresh water tank is filled and connected properly.

Awning Malfunctions

If your awning isn’t functioning properly, try the following:

  • Check for obstructions that may be blocking the awning’s movement.
  • Inspect the awning’s motor and wiring.
  • Make sure the awning is clean and free of debris.
